Ser Jared Frey is a member of House Frey. He is the fourth son of Lord Walder Frey. And was the first son born from Lord Walders marriage to his second wife Cyrenna Swann. He is married to Alys Frey.[1]

Appearance
Ser Jared is a tall, stooped man of fifty years.[2] He is lean, balding and pockmarked.[3] He was long and lean of limb and clean-shaved but for a tin grey mustache[4],
Recent Events
A Game of Thrones
He attended the Tourney of the Hand at King's Landing with five of his brothers.[5] He was too old to ride in the lists. He attended Lord Walder at the parley with Lady Catelyn Stark. He is one of the Freys placed under Robb Stark's command after the parley ended.[6]
A Clash of Kings
Ser Jared is a member of the Frey contingent that is a part of Lord Roose Bolton's army at Harrenhal. He was once a captive of House Lannister.[7]
A Feast for Crows
Jared is dispatched with two other Freys to negotiate a peace between the Iron Throne and White Harbour.
A Dance with Dragons
Jared along with Rhaegar Frey and Symond Frey went to White Harbour to return the bones of Wendel Manderly (who was murdered at the Red Wedding) to his father Wyman Manderly. They also went to ensure White Harbour bends the knee to the Iron Throne. They offered Wyman Manderly a Frey bride and betrothals of Rhaegar Frey to his granddaughter Wynafryd and Little Walder Frey to Wyman's other granddaughter Wylla.
When Davos Seaworth arrived in White Harbour to try and persuade House Manderly to support Stannis Baratheon, all three of the Freys were present. Ser Jared claimed that the Red Wedding was Robb Stark's doing and that he turned into a Warg along with his Northmen and would have killed Walder Frey but Wendel Manderly put himself in the way and was killed by Robb Stark. The lie shocked Ser Davos and he called Ser Jared a liar. Ser Jared drew his sword and was close to attacking Davos till Wyman Manderly said he would have no bloodshed in Merman's court.[8]
Wyman knew Ser Jared was lying but since the Iron Throne held his heir he pretended to believe the lie and pretended to order Davos put to death and had a criminal with similar features executed and his head dipped in tar so the Freys falsely believed Davos dead. As a reward for proving his loyalty the Iron Throne returned Wyman's heir Wylis Manderly to him.
According to Wyman Manderly, Rhaegar, Jared and Symond were given palfreys as "guest gifts" (guest gifts are usually given when a guest leaves, making them no longer under the protection of guest right) when the three Freys departed White Harbour. Wyman claimed they were all to meet at Winterfell for the wedding of "Arya Stark" to Ramsay Bolton. They were not seen since though Aenys Frey and Hosteen Frey who were present at Winterfell suspect Wyman Manderly of foul play.
Also at the wedding feast Wyman Manderly presented three huge pies at the feast while requesting a song from the singer Abel about the Rat Cook; this implied to readers that the three Freys were actually present at the wedding after all. see Frey Pies/Theories
